The Current State of Power Backup in Belgium

Analyzing the demand for robust diesel generator set technology in the Heart of Europe.

Belgium's industrial sector, characterized by high-density manufacturing and critical logistics hubs like the Port of Antwerp-Bruges, demands an uncompromising level of power stability. The integration of a high-capacity diesel generator set has become a standard requirement for facilities where a few seconds of downtime can result in significant financial loss.

Climate-wise, Belgium's temperate maritime climate requires equipment that can withstand high humidity and sudden temperature shifts. This has led to an increased demand for weather-protected and durable housing for power systems, ensuring that emergency power remains available during the unpredictable North Sea weather patterns.

Furthermore, strict European noise pollution regulations and the "Green Deal" initiatives have shifted the market toward the silent diesel generator. Belgian companies are now prioritizing low-emission engines and advanced acoustic enclosures to comply with urban zoning laws in cities like Ghent and Liege.

Evolution of Power Generation in Belgium

From traditional mechanical backups to smart, synchronized power grids.

Market Development History

In the late 20th century, Belgian industry relied on heavy, manually-started mechanical units. These early systems provided raw power but lacked the precision and efficiency required for modern sensitive electronic equipment, serving primarily as basic emergency backups for heavy machinery.

Between 2000 and 2015, the market transitioned toward the widespread adoption of the diesel generator with Automatic Transfer Switches (ATS). This era focused on reducing response times and improving fuel efficiency to meet the rising energy costs in the Eurozone.

From 2016 to the present, the focus has shifted toward digitalization and emissions control. The introduction of Stage V emission standards in Europe forced a technological leap, resulting in the current generation of intelligent power sets that offer remote monitoring and ultra-low particulate output.

Future Development Trends

Hybridization of Power Sources

We predict a surge in hybrid systems where traditional diesel power is paired with battery storage (BESS) to reduce fuel consumption during low-load periods.

Hydrogen-Ready Engines

Following EU sustainability trends, the next 5 years will see a transition toward dual-fuel engines capable of running on HVO (Hydrotreated Vegetable Oil) or hydrogen blends.

IoT-Driven Predictive Maintenance

Google search trends indicate a rising interest in "Smart Grid" and "Remote Power Monitoring," suggesting that AI-driven diagnostics will soon replace scheduled manual inspections.

Industry Outlook

The future of power generation in Belgium is inextricably linked to the transition toward "Energy-as-a-Service." We anticipate that generators will no longer be static assets but active participants in the energy grid, capable of peak shaving and supporting renewable energy intermittency.

As Belgium continues to lead in chemical and pharmaceutical manufacturing, the demand for high-reliability industrial diesel generator units will remain strong, though the focus will shift heavily toward "Green Diesel" and integrated smart control systems.

Localized Application Scenarios in Belgium

Real-world implementations of our power solutions across different Belgian sectors.

01. Port Logistics & Cold Storage (Antwerp/Zeebrugge)

High-capacity industrial diesel generator units are used to power massive refrigeration systems, preventing perishable cargo loss during grid outages at Europe's busiest ports.

02. Pharmaceutical Manufacturing (Wallonia Bio-Cluster)

Critical labs and clean rooms utilize synchronized generator sets to ensure that temperature-sensitive vaccines and biologics remain stable without a millisecond of power interruption.

03. Urban Event Management (Brussels Expo/Grand Place)

The use of a silent diesel generator allows for the powering of large-scale public events and exhibitions while adhering to strict city noise ordinances.

04. Emergency Mobile Support (Construction Sites)

A portable diesel generator is deployed for temporary power in infrastructure projects, such as railway upgrades or highway expansions throughout Flanders.

05. Data Center Redundancy (Brussels Digital Hub)

Tier III and IV data centers employ massive diesel generator set arrays to maintain 99.999% uptime for cloud services and financial transactions.
